Patricia Cavanaugh Obituary

Patricia Stambaugh Cavanaugh, a fine artist, trained vocalist, and skilled horsewoman and mariner, passed away May 7, 2021, in Newark, Ohio, at the age of 96. She was born in Fulton, Kentucky, to the late Clem and Beulah Stambaugh.

Pat attended Stephens College and the Cleveland Institute of Art. After she married her childhood sweetheart, John Cavanaugh, they moved to Louisville, Kentucky, where he got his DMD and she worked for the Kentucky Crippled Children’s Association. In 1958, they moved back to Youngstown to raise their children. Pat managed the family dental practice, working alongside her husband and father.  She was member of the Mahoning Valley Polo Club, Youngstown Philharmonic, and was actively involved with the Children’s Playhouse. Her greatest joy was raising three girls. She will be remembered as a loving mother and grandmother who was vibrant, funny, threw a great party and loved color.

Surviving are her daughters, Ann Clinton Cavanaugh, Alexandra R. Cavanaugh, and Nancy Cavanaugh Andreano; grandchildren, Wood Cavanaugh Struthers, Alexandra Taylor Struthers, Thomas Malachi Andreano, and Jacqueline Patricia Andreano; great grandchildren, Robert Wood Struthers, Finnegan John Struthers, Saffron Rae Teck, and Willem Blaise Teck.

In addition to her parents and husband, Pat was preceded in death by her sister, Ann.

A private service will be held at Forest Lawn Memorial Park Cemetery in Youngstown, Ohio this summer.
